迭代器钻取:查找 学习目标 演示find() 使用find()隔离特定结果 介绍 在任何编程语言中,您都将对数组执行操作。在Array查找子字符串或字符集是一项常见的任务。有时您需要在数组中查找特定项目,然后将其返回。给定字符串或数组,您可以遍历其元素并执行操作。 ES6引入了一些新的Array方法-其中之一是find() 。 演示find() find函数的行为与JavaScript中的其他函数(例如filter )类似,它们需要真实/错误的结果。 find返回该函数返回true的第一个元素,即单个元素。 [ 1 , 3 , 5 , 6 , 8 ] . find ( function ( e ) { return e % 2 === 0 } ) 注意:您可能有多个匹配项,但是find仅返回第一个元素。如果您不小心,可能会导致一些错误。 let roommates = [ "jess